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es
Yield: 12 muffins
Directions and Instructions
-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). To make clean-up a breeze, line a muffin tin with paper liners.
- In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, packed brown sugar, granulated s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t until they are well combined.
- In a separate bowl, combine the melted butter, eggs, milk, and vanilla extract. Whisk these ingredients together until smooth and uniform.
- Pour the wet ingredients into the bowl with the dry ingredients, and gently mix until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; it’s okay if there are a few lumps!
- Gently fold in the chopped pecans, which will add a lovely crunch to each bite.
- Use a spoon or ice cream scoop to fill each muffin cup about halfway with the batter, allowing room for the muffins to rise.
- Place the muffin tin in the oven and b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ean.
- Once baked, let the muffins cool in the pan for about 5 minutes before carefully trans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Notes or Tips
- For an extra touch, consider sprinkling some additional chopped pecans on top of the muffins right before baking.
- These muffins are perfect for freezing! Place them in an airtight container and store them in the freezer for up to 2 months. Just reheat in the microwave for a quick snack.
- Feel free to experiment with other mix-ins, such as chocolate chips or dried fruit, to personalize your muffins.
Cooking Techniques
When mixing your muffin batter, remember the key to tender muffins is to avoid overmixing. Mixing just until combined helps to achieve a light and fluffy texture. Additionally, using room temperature ingredients can help them blend more easily, ensuring a smooth and consistent batter.
